STATE v. SAMUDIO

No. 84-1067.

460 So.2d 419 (1984)

STATE of Florida, Appellant, v. Nester SAMUDIO, Appellee.

District Court of Appeal of Florida, Second District.

November 14, 1984.


Attorney(s) appearing for the Case

Jim Smith, Atty. Gen., Tallahassee, and Robert J. Krauss, Asst. Atty. Gen., Tampa, for appellant.

Jerry Hill, Public Defender, and Larry G. Bryant, Asst. Public Defender, Bartow, for appellee.


SCHOONOVER, Judge.

Appellant, the State of Florida, appeals from the judgment and sentences imposed against appellee, Nester Samudio. We agree with the state's contention that the trial court erred in sentencing Mr. Samudio, and, accordingly, we reverse.
